Independent Contractors vs Employees 22-23

With the staff shortages and brainstorming means to hire, it is important to understand the difference between independent contractors and employees. What you do & don't know CAN hurt you! In the past years, dozens of school districts have been audited by the IRS. If the IRS determines that a district has misclassified an employee as an independent contractor, the district can owe three times the employment taxes. We will review the guidelines for determining status as an independent contractor and the issues that arise during the transition from employee to contractor for the school district or charter.
